Lots of buzz out there now about State Bird Provisions, an in-the-works restaurant marking the return of Stuart Brioza and Nicole Krasinski to restaurant land. The husband-and-wife chef team was last seen at Rubicon, which closed in 2008 after a 14-year run on Sacramento St.. And lets just say they've been sorely missed ever since. In a totally unexpected move, Brioza and Krasinsky have dreamt up a casual, very reasonably priced, small plates concept. They'll serve up a rotation of about 40 dishes, dim-sum-style, but the flavors and inspiration will come from all over the world. Madame Hopper mentions a few potential dishes, like beef top round with spicy eggplant and chicken hearts with salsa verde.
The restaurant will have about 50 seats and a shock of energy from the open kitchen. There's a big buildout in store at its future address next to The Fillmore. The opening is expected to happen around November. Check back in for the lastest developments.
